Teleos Ag's New Potato-Specific Crop Page

Using TELONE by Teleos soil fumigant to prep the soil ahead of planting creates a zone of protection, allowing delicate roots to establish into healthy potatoes. Using TELONE in combination with chloropicrin also helps suppress many soilborne diseases that affect potatoes, including verticillium, common scab, rhizoctonia, fusarium, pythium, and more!
